4 Steps on How to Avoid MyBizCard spam
In a Google search on how to stop this madness I found a really helpful post by Su Butcher. Thankfully, you can avoid MyBizCard spam and you can remove access to your information through LinkedIn by following these instructions:
In your LinkedIn profile:
1. Go to your "privacy and settings" page (drop down menu by your photo in the top right hand corner – in earlier versions of LinkedIn the menu was by your name)
2. Choose the "Groups, Companies and Applications" tab;
3. Click on "View your Applications";
4. Find "MyBizCard" from the list, tick the checkbox and click the "Remove" button.
